Gang robs from private mill employees near Tirupur

November 29, 2013 03:59 pm | Updated 03:59 pm IST - Tirupur

Two employees of a private mill near Kangayam were allegedly robbed by a gang who came in cars on Friday.

The accused reportedly took away a sum of Rs. 22 lakh from the two mill employees, who were on the way to remit the amount in a bank.

Later in the day, the police had picked up two persons for questioning. According to police sources, Rs. two lakh had been recovered from the two persons. The search is on for the remaining persons and the balance cash.
